The Last Word: Blood Brothers

Scott, John and Kris Droegkamp learned many of life’s lessons from their father, who founded Dave Droegkamp Heating Inc. in Hartland 27 years ago. Perhaps no lesson was more important than to emphasize the importance of keeping family harmony while still maintaining a profitable business that serves all of its stakeholders. That balancing act is not easily attained and requires constant nurturing, according to Scott Droegkamp, who shares his insights about running a family business here.

“If I told you the three of us got along all the time, I would be lying. We have had, and still have, some major battles from time to time. Respecting, listening and compromising are perhaps some of what has kept us together for more than two decades.

“Forbearance and perseverance are words that come to mind when things are not going good and you just stick together because you are brothers. There is no one that knows you better than a brother, so you kind of communicate in a very special way. Parking our egos has also helped us, along with each one working in the field, gaining experience and understanding what goes on in many of the situations that our employees face on a daily basis. Being honest, treating others fairly and truly caring builds trust and respect that trickles on down from ownership, to employees and to the customer.

“When things start to unravel with us, it usually has to do with communication (or lack thereof). It is then time to sit down and speak your heart and resolve whatever is going on. Especially with what is going on in today’s economy. Stressful situations are everywhere, and being able to deal with people, their unique challenges and show that you really care can make a big difference.

“‘Your comfort is our family’s tradition’ is our company’s motto and a legacy that each one of us takes very seriously and is lived out on a daily basis. I guess you could say, ‘It’s in our blood.'”
